Physical activity is the strongest predictor of all-cause mortality in patients with COPD: a prospective cohort study.

In this paper, the authors determined the prognostic value of objectively measured physical activity in comparison with established predictors of mortality and evaluated the prognosis value of noninvasive assessments of cardiovascular status, biomarkers of systemic inflammation, and adipokines.
